When a star more than 20 times the size of our sun dies it explodes into a supernova. Some matter collapses down into an extremely dense object called a black hole. These cosmic voids of darkness exert such a strong gravitational force that absolutely nothing, not even light, can escape their pull. As matter and light fall into the black hole like water circling a drain they form an enormous swirling ring called an accretion disk which is a flattened cloud-like structure of gas, plasma, dust, and particles in space.
